  7. Gilbert–Shannon–Reeds model -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Gilbert–Shannon–Reeds...

    In the mathematics of shuffling playing cards, the Gilbert–Shannon–Reeds model is a probability distribution on riffle shuffle permutations. [1] It forms the basis for a recommendation that a deck of cards should be riffled seven times in order to thoroughly randomize it.
